Transaction 31a728fb1372bbacc537a85247f67e587ece6999af2f6a7cf397ef54377600af
1 Input
2 Outputs
- 31a728fb1372bbacc537a85247f67e587ece6999af2f6a7cf397ef54377600af:0
- 31a728fb1372bbacc537a85247f67e587ece6999af2f6a7cf397ef54377600af:1
value 1637383
address 1ADy8cY98EDPCXzKK3ywfQhZ7b1bYuv7FA
value 281308
address 33BsxAKG2obb5rrfWY1TChhxXu227uyLHH